Ordinals
beta
Sat 1861581601375685
decimal
668530.351375685
degree
0°38530′1234″351375685‴
percentile
88.64674302016311%
name
aqwrfxiplei
cycle
0
epoch
3
period
331
block
668530
offset
351375685
timestamp
2021-01-31 20:43:57 UTC
rarity
common
prev
next